程序员如何在快速变化的行业中保持竞争力?
在当今科技飞速发展的时代,程序员面临着前所未有的挑战。新技术层出不穷,市场需求瞬息万变,如何在激烈的竞争中保持竞争力成为每个程序员必须思考的问题。本文将探讨程序员如何通过不断学习、优化工作流程以及利用智能化工具如InsCode AI IDE来提升自己的竞争力。
最新接入DeepSeek-V3模型,点击下载最新版本InsCode AI IDE
1. 持续学习:紧跟技术潮流
编程语言和框架的更新换代速度极快,程序员必须保持持续学习的习惯。无论是掌握新的编程语言,还是深入理解现有的技术栈,都需要投入大量的时间和精力。然而,时间是有限的,如何高效地学习新知识成为了关键。
应用场景: InsCode AI IDE 提供了强大的智能问答功能,允许用户通过自然对话与IDE互动,应对编程领域的多种挑战。例如,在学习一门新语言时,开发者可以通过AI对话框输入问题,获取语法指导、代码示例以及最佳实践建议。这种交互式的学习方式不仅提高了学习效率,还帮助开发者更快地掌握新技术。
巨大价值: 通过InsCode AI IDE,程序员可以随时随地进行高效学习,无需查阅大量文档或求助他人。AI助手能够根据开发者的需求提供个性化的学习路径,确保他们始终处于技术前沿。
2. 提高开发效率:优化工作流程
在实际工作中,开发效率直接关系到项目的成功与否。高效的开发流程不仅可以缩短项目周期,还能提高代码质量,减少错误。因此,程序员需要不断优化自己的工作流程,寻找更便捷的工具和技术。
应用场景: InsCode AI IDE 支持全局代码生成/改写,改写模式会理解整个项目,并生成/修改多个文件(包含生成图片资源)。这意味着开发者可以在短时间内完成复杂的编码任务,而无需手动编写每一行代码。此外,InsCode AI IDE 还具备代码补全、智能问答、解释代码、添加注释、生成单元测试等多种功能,极大地简化了开发过程。
巨大价值: 借助InsCode AI IDE,程序员可以显著提高开发效率,专注于创意和设计,而不是繁琐的编码细节。这不仅节省了时间,还提升了代码的质量和可维护性,使开发者能够在更短的时间内交付高质量的产品。
3. 创新思维:探索新技术和工具
创新是保持竞争力的核心要素之一。程序员不仅要掌握现有技术,还要勇于尝试新技术和工具,以满足不断变化的市场需求。创新不仅仅体现在技术层面,还包括工作方法和思维方式的革新。
应用场景: InsCode AI IDE 接入了最新的DeepSeek-V3模型,实现了智能编程的完美融合。通过内置的DeepSeek模块,InsCode AI IDE 能够更精准地理解开发者的需求,提供更加智能的代码生成和优化建议。例如,在编写复杂算法时,开发者只需输入自然语言描述,DeepSeek即可自动生成相应的代码片段,极大地简化了编程过程。
巨大价值: DeepSeek的智能推荐功能还能根据开发者的编程习惯,提供个性化的代码优化建议,进一步提升代码质量。这种智能化的编程体验不仅提高了工作效率,还激发了开发者的创新思维,使他们在面对复杂问题时能够找到更优的解决方案。
4. 团队协作:提升沟通和协作能力
现代软件开发往往是团队合作的结果,良好的沟通和协作能力对于项目的成功至关重要。程序员需要与设计师、产品经理、测试人员等多角色密切配合,共同推动项目进展。因此,提升团队协作能力也是保持竞争力的重要方面。
应用场景: InsCode AI IDE 支持Git集成,开发者可以在不离开代码编辑器的情况下使用源代码版本控制功能。此外,InsCode AI IDE 还提供了丰富的扩展和插件支持,允许团队成员根据需求定制各自的开发环境。通过这些功能,团队成员可以更高效地协作,共享代码库、管理任务和跟踪进度。
巨大价值: InsCode AI IDE 的协作功能不仅提高了团队的工作效率,还促进了成员之间的沟通和交流。统一的开发环境使得团队成员更容易理解和维护彼此的代码,减少了误解和重复劳动,提升了整体生产力。
5. 自我提升:培养综合素质
除了技术和工具的提升,程序员还需要注重自身综合素质的培养。良好的时间管理、解决问题的能力、沟通技巧等都是影响职业生涯发展的关键因素。通过不断提升这些软技能,程序员可以在职场中脱颖而出。
应用场景: InsCode AI IDE 提供了直观的键盘快捷键和易于定制的功能,帮助开发者轻松浏览代码,提高日常工作效率。同时,InsCode AI IDE 的智能问答功能还可以帮助开发者快速解决遇到的问题,减少调试时间,提升问题解决能力。
巨大价值: 通过使用InsCode AI IDE,程序员不仅可以提高技术能力,还能培养良好的工作习惯和解决问题的能力。这种全方位的提升有助于他们在职业生涯中取得更大的成功。
结语
在快速变化的技术环境中,程序员必须不断学习、优化工作流程、探索新技术、提升团队协作能力和培养综合素质,才能保持竞争力。而像InsCode AI IDE这样的智能化工具,无疑是程序员提升自我、迎接挑战的最佳帮手。它不仅简化了开发过程,提高了工作效率,还激发了创新思维,为程序员的职业发展注入了新的动力。
如果您希望在编程领域保持领先地位,不妨下载并试用InsCode AI IDE,体验智能化编程带来的便利和高效。未来已来,让我们一起迎接智能编程的新时代!